Detailed Game DescriptionLords of Irongate was originally inspired by role playing dungeon adventure games such as netHack, Rogue, and Moria (Amiga). This version III attempts to build on that and expand it to create a virtually unlimited dungeon which includes a distributed multiplayer universe of user configurable pseudo-random worlds, 2d graphics, a growing database of hundreds of monsters/items/spells and platform independence. The game was written as a pure "highly optimized" java application so any platform that has a Java2 virtual machine can run it (All Windows, Mac, Linux, Amiga, BeOs, OS2... whatever [not all platforms shown here were tested - please report any critical non-windows platform issues]. For common platforms, we optionally include a small virtual machine distribution with the install (recommended if you want to be sure to run the game right away). Lords of Irongate, on the other hand, has a somewhat unique distributed server approach where players actually randomly direct connect to one another (each time they travel through a magic portal). Every copy of Irongate "is" both a client and "is capable" of operating as a full game server for other players at the same time. The server only starts if explicitly configured to do so (multiplayer setting in world options panel), and only when you load a player. The level that your player is in, becomes the level that other players can travel to by entering through the magic portals. Players communicate by either (S)houting {text} to all other players on level, or by talking to only the visible players using [space]{text}. ![]() The server continues to run if you (as a player) enter a portal and leave to another other world. However your server does shut down if you select to 'quit' (returning you to main menu). Because all the worlds are distributed, there has to be a way for your player to determine where to teleport to - that is where OUR list server (and registration) is important. We maintain both a database of registered users who can use multi-player features, and a centralized list server. Our list server gets a message from all the distributed worlds when their server becomes activate (and if a legit server we add them to our 'active' worlds list). Later, when the list server receives requests from any (registered) player who enters a magic portal, the list server then hands them a small random subset of available worlds (in their zone) to direct connect to. To optimize for network bandwidth limitations, only different delta's are transfered between clients and server (they both have matching databases of common images/ items/ monsters/ effects/ etc..). Therefore, this is where the list server is critical - it ensures that clients are only given servers which are 'database' compatible with theirs. Of course, most all this is part of the magic "behind the scenes." |
